Nancy Bowman Obituary

Talented Artist, Beloved Wife, Mother, and Friend

Nancy, 78, of Morgan Hill, California, passed away at her home on November 15, 2020 after a fierce battle with ovarian cancer. Her final days were spent with those she loved. Her last breath was taken in the arms of her children.
Born in Worcester, Massachusetts to Charles and Marjorie Stewart, Nancy was a beloved big sister to brothers Charles, Robert, John, and Terry. At age seven, the family moved to Southern California. The first in her family to go to college, she graduated UCLA with a degree in Education and a teaching credential in hand. In 1964, she married William Hiller and settled in San Jose, California. Together they had three children, Stephen followed by twins Michelle and Melissa. She created a beautiful home filled with love, laughter, gourmet food, and an endless supply of encouragement to her family and friends.
Though lifelong friends, Nancy and Bill's marriage ended and she fell in love again and married Robert Bowman in 1978. The two families blended gifting Nancy two more children, Robert and Mary Beth, along with a new friend in Mary, their mother. The two families bought a historic, tree filled property, graced with fountains and an abundance of rockwork in Morgan Hill. The families remained close and ended up with houses walking distance apart, where they made a life filled with their children, grandchildren, great grandchildren, friends, and fun.
Though her father had encouraged becoming an educator due to its practical nature, Nancy would go on to discover her true calling -- the visual arts. From developing new areas on her property, each named and themed, where one could go to reflect or just enjoy a picnic or a simple cup of tea, to capturing beautiful moments in her travels as a photographer, which she made into cards and sold in boutique stores all over Northern California, Nancy graced us with her artistry and joy. Nancy's most enduring artistic legacy will be her sculptures, which have been displayed in galleries in America and Europe and which continue to be sold in galleries in Carmel, California. Nancy's bronzes embody pure feminine beauty in her willowy and statuesque figures. They will forever be a testament to her lovely and enduring spirit.
A great listener, friend, and simply a wonderful and beautiful person, Nancy is survived by her spouse, three brothers, four children, ten grandchildren, and three great grandchildren. In lieu of flowers, the family suggests that donations be made in her honor to St. Jude's Hospital for Children.The family will hold a memorial service on her property in the Spring, when her garden is at its best.
